Low Carb Caesar Salad with Chicken

Enjoy a healthy and delicious Low Carb Caesar Salad with Chicken. This recipe features a homemade Caesar dressing and perfectly cooked chicken for a satisfying meal.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Servings: 4 bowls
Course: dinner, Lunch, Main Course
Cuisine: American
Calories: 450

Ingredients
  

Low Carb Homemade Caesar Salad Dressing
  • 3/4 cup mayonnaise
  • 1/2 cup grated parmesan cheese
  • 1 ounce Anchovies ini olive oil (4 Anchovy filets)
  • 4 cloves fresh garlic
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• pinch of salt
Low Carb Chicken Caesar Salad
  • 1 pound Chicken Breasts
  • salt to taste
  • pepper to taste
  • 6 cups Romain Lettuce
  • 1/4 cup parmesan cheese
  • 1/2 cup parmesan crisps

Method
 

  1. Place all dressing ingredients into a blender and pulse until well blended.
  2. Pour into a salad dressing container and refrigerate until ready to serve.
  3. Heat a medium pan over medium heat. Slice chicken in half to create two thin slices.
  4. Pat chicken dry and season with salt and pepper. Cook on both sides until golden brown and internal temperature reaches 165°F.
  5. Place lettuce, parmesan, and crisps into a large bowl.
  6. Pour dressing over the salad and toss until well coated.
  7. Divide the salad into 4 bowls.
  8. Slice the chicken and place on top of the salad.
